Exploring the History of Jogia
Now, let’s talk history. Jogia, or Yogyakarta, has been around for centuries, and it’s steeped in tradition and heritage. This city was once the heart of the Mataram Sultanate, a powerful kingdom that ruled over Java during the 16th century. The legacy of the sultans is still alive today, and you can see it in the grand palaces, the traditional ceremonies, and even in the everyday lives of the people.

One of the highlights of Jogia’s history is the Kraton Yogyakarta, the royal palace that serves as the residence of the Sultan. It’s not just a building—it’s a symbol of the city’s rich cultural heritage. Visiting the Kraton is like stepping back in time, surrounded by intricate carvings, ornate decorations, and stories of the past. Oh, and don’t forget to check out the museum inside—it’s packed with artifacts that’ll give you a glimpse into the life of the royal family.
Key Historical Landmarks in Jogia
- Borobudur Temple: A UNESCO World Heritage Site and a must-visit for anyone interested in ancient architecture.
- Prambanan Temple: Another UNESCO World Heritage Site, this Hindu temple complex is a marvel of craftsmanship and design.
- Kraton Yogyakarta: The royal palace of the Sultan, a living testament to the city’s rich history.
- Water Castle (Taman Sari): An abandoned water palace that’s shrouded in mystery and legend.
Jogia’s Cultural Scene: A Feast for the Senses
Culture is at the heart of everything in Jogia. The city is a hub for traditional arts, music, and dance, and you’ll find performances happening all over town. Whether you’re watching a wayang kulit puppet show, attending a gamelan concert, or learning how to make traditional batik, you’ll be immersed in the vibrant cultural tapestry of this city.
One of the coolest things about Jogia’s cultural scene is how accessible it is. You don’t have to be an expert to appreciate the beauty of a Javanese dance performance or the intricate patterns of a batik cloth. In fact, many places offer workshops where you can try your hand at creating your own piece of art. It’s a hands-on way to connect with the culture and take home a unique souvenir.
Top Cultural Experiences in Jogia
- Wayang Kulit: Shadow puppet theater that tells epic tales of heroes and gods.
- Gamelan Music: Traditional Javanese music played on percussion instruments.
- Batik Workshops: Learn the art of creating beautiful patterns on fabric.
- Javanese Dance: Graceful movements that tell stories through dance.
The Food Scene in Jogia: A Gourmet Adventure
Okay, let’s talk about the elephant in the room—food. Jogia is a paradise for foodies, and you’ll never run out of delicious things to try. From street food stalls to fancy restaurants, the city offers a wide range of culinary delights that’ll make your taste buds dance. And don’t even get me started on gudeg, the city’s signature dish made from young jackfruit cooked in coconut milk.
But it’s not just about gudeg. Jogia is also famous for its bakpia, a pastry filled with mung bean paste that’s perfect for snacking. And if you’re in the mood for something sweet, make sure to try klepon, glutinous rice balls filled with melted palm sugar and coated in grated coconut. Trust me, you’ll want to eat them by the dozen.
Must-Try Dishes in Jogia
- Gudeg: A savory dish made from young jackfruit, chicken, and coconut milk.
- Bakpia: A flaky pastry filled with sweet mung bean paste.
- Klepon: Sweet glutinous rice balls filled with melted palm sugar.
- Sate Klatak: Grilled meat skewers served with a spicy peanut sauce.
Natural Wonders of Jogia: Where Nature Meets Adventure
While Jogia is famous for its cultural and historical attractions, it’s also a haven for nature lovers. The city is surrounded by breathtaking landscapes, from rugged mountains to pristine beaches. If you’re looking for adventure, you’ll find plenty of opportunities to explore the great outdoors.
One of the most popular natural attractions in Jogia is Mount Merapi, an active volcano that offers thrilling hiking experiences. For those who prefer something a little calmer, the beaches of Parangtritis and Krakal are perfect for relaxing and soaking up the sun. And if you’re into waterfalls, don’t miss the stunning Oya Waterfall, where you can cool off with a refreshing dip.
Best Natural Attractions in Jogia
- Mount Merapi: A challenging hike with breathtaking views.
- Parangtritis Beach: A picturesque beach with black sand and strong waves.
- Oya Waterfall: A serene spot for a refreshing swim.
- Kalibiru Forest: A scenic park with stunning views of the valley.
Practical Tips for Traveling to Jogia
Now that you’re convinced to visit Jogia, let’s talk about how to make the most of your trip. First things first, when’s the best time to go? The dry season, which runs from April to October, is the ideal time to visit. The weather is sunny and perfect for outdoor activities, and you’ll avoid the monsoon rains that can make travel a bit tricky.
When it comes to getting around, taxis and ride-hailing apps like Gojek are your best bet. They’re affordable, convenient, and will take you wherever you need to go. And if you’re feeling adventurous, you can rent a scooter or a car to explore the city at your own pace. Just remember to drive carefully—the traffic can be a little chaotic!
Packing Essentials for Your Jogia Adventure
- Comfortable walking shoes: You’ll be doing a lot of walking, so make sure your feet are happy.
- Sunscreen: The sun in Jogia can be intense, so protect your skin!
- A reusable water bottle: Stay hydrated and eco-friendly at the same time.
- A lightweight jacket: The evenings can get a bit chilly, especially if you’re hiking a volcano.
